New Delhi: Amid a latest surge in COVID-19 circumstances throughout India, the third phase of COVID-19 vaccination commences on April 1. The first phase of the innoculation drive had begun in January and healthcare staff and frontline staff had been vaccinated.

In the second phase senior residents (above 60 years of age) and other people aged 45 or older with comorbidities had been eligible to vaccine doses.

Now, within the third phase, individuals aged 45 or above with none comorbidities are eligible to get vaccinated.

HERE’S HOW TO REGISTER

Citizens can register onsite by strolling in to the closest vaccination centre after 3 PM or they’ll select to register on-line.

Online registeration may be achieved via the cowin.gov.in web site or Aarogya Setu app which has CoWin integration.

The course of to register is identical for each the web site and the app. 

* To register you possibly can enter your cellphone quantity and enter the One-Time Password (OTP).

* You will probably be required to enter the picture ID sort, picture ID quantity and fill in particulars like age, gender.

* You can use your Driving License, Aadhaar Card, PAN Card and others as picture ID proof.

* One particular person can register for up to 4 individuals with a registered cellular quantity.

Further, you’ll need to enter particulars like State/Union Territory, District, Block, Pincode to seek for a vaccination centre close by. You can select the date to get the vaccine shot.

Once registered, you’ll need to log in with the identical cellular quantity as registered to make any appointment adjustments.
